FDNY pours cold water on steamy charity calendar

NEW YORK — The Fire Department poured cold water on a steamy charity calendar featuring photographs of shirtless firefighters after learning that one of its stars had also appeared nude in a “Guys Gone Wild” video.

Fire Commissioner Nicholas Scoppetta on Friday informed the charity that produces the calendar that it will no longer allow firefighters to participate, a department spokesman said.

The decision was made after the department learned that the cover boy for the 2008 “Calendar of Heroes,” a firefighter with a ladder company in Brooklyn, had also appeared naked in a salacious 2004 DVD.

The “Guys Gone Wild” video was unrelated to the calendar, but Fire Officials apparently decided the publication was compromising its reputation.

The annual calendar is published by the FDNY Fire Foundation, which annually raised about $150,000 per year for department equipment and training.

The foundation’s executive director, Jean O’Shea, told the Daily News that he accepted the decision.

“We’re disappointed, but the department’s reputation is more important than raising money,” O’Shea said.
